The fog began to lift as our boat gently drifted towards the Sangam, the sacred confluence of the Ganges and Yamuna rivers, where legend whispers of the mythical Saraswati joining their embrace. The blue-grey waters of the Ganges mingled with the placid, emerald-tinged Yamuna while migratory birds flitted across the surface, their calls adding to the symphony of the morning. Chilled by the river breeze, the air at the Maha Kumbh Mela 2025 hummed with the divine chants of “Har Har Mahadev” and “Jai Gange“, creating a sensory overload that both invigorated and overwhelmed me.
